Description
Multiple PHP remote file inclusion vulnerabilities in OpenConcept Back-End CMS 0.4.7 all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code via a URL in the includes_path parameter to (1) click.php or (2) pollcollector.php in htdocs/; or (3) index.php, (4) articlepages.php, (5) articles.php, (6) articleform.php, (7) articlesections.php, (8) createArticlesPage.php, (9) guestbook.php, (10) helpguide.php, (11) helpguideeditor.php, (12) links.php, (13) upload.php, (14) sitestatistics.php, (15) nav.php, (16) tpl_upload.php, (17) linksections, or (18) pophelp.php in htdocs/site-admin/; different vectors than CVE-2006-5076. NOTE: this issue is disputed by a third party, who states that $includes_path is defined before use
